Frequently Asked Questions about Amherst

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Amherst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Amherst ranges from $434 to $1,599 with an average monthly rent of $1,092.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Amherst c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Amherst range from $523 to $2,999.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,328.

How expensive are Amherst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 9 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Amherst on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$590 to $1,900 - averaging $1,265 for the location.
